mirror of
https://github.com/puppetmaster/typhoon.git
synced 2025-07-29 19:41:33 +02:00
Mask docker.service to prevent socket activation
* Kubelet now uses `containerd` as the container runtime, but `docker.service` still starts when `docker.sock` is probed bc the service is socket activated. Prevent this by masking the `docker.service` unit
This commit is contained in:
@ -31,6 +31,8 @@ systemd:
|
||||
WantedBy=multi-user.target
|
||||
- name: containerd.service
|
||||
enabled: true
|
||||
- name: docker.service
|
||||
mask: true
|
||||
- name: wait-for-dns.service
|
||||
enabled: true
|
||||
contents: |
|
||||
|
@ -5,6 +5,8 @@ systemd:
|
||||
units:
|
||||
- name: containerd.service
|
||||
enabled: true
|
||||
- name: docker.service
|
||||
mask: true
|
||||
- name: wait-for-dns.service
|
||||
enabled: true
|
||||
contents: |
|
||||
|
Reference in New Issue
Block a user